Your insolvency specialist might suggest alternative volunteer financial obligation arrangements that might be a much better alternative for insolvent firms, such as a Firm Voluntary Plan (CVA). A CVA is a good choice to trying to prepare an informal agreement with your lenders.

Because it is a lawfully binding agreement, and as long as the proposal has actually been agreed by all the financial institutions, the company can proceed to trade. The insolvency professional remains to manage the CVA, which is usually for a term of 3 to 5 years, till it concerns an end.

Quiting a winding up request hazard. Bringing money owed to lenders right into one monthly repayment to the manager, the bankruptcy specialist. Expenses much less than administration or a Plan of Setup. Will enhance capital and allow the business to proceed to trade. The initial job is to guarantee that the bankruptcy expert near you is certified and is a participant of among the Recognised Specialist Bodies (RPBs) in the UK, which are: Insolvency Practitioners Association Institute of Chartered Accountants of England and Wales Institute of Chartered Accountants in Scotland Institute of Chartered Accountants in Ireland Only certified bankruptcy practitioners are allowed to act in financially troubled firm and personal bankruptcy procedures, including serving as a liquidator, a manager or a manager of a CVA.

This is where insolvency experts enter into play. An insolvency professional is accountable for minimising the result of bankruptcy on various creditors and stakeholders whilst making certain the company possessions are all recovered to the max level feasible. They look out for each event involved and are unbiased in their choice making, acting based on different pieces of regulations.

If you do not appoint your own specialists, then they will be designated for you by the Court. A bankruptcy practitioner has 2 major duties.
